What Is a Timing Pulley?

A timing pulley is a mechanical transmission component featuring specially designed teeth that match the tooth profile of a timing belt.

In conventional belt and pulley systems, motion is transmitted through friction. In timing belt systems, however, the teeth of the belt engage directly with the pulley profile. This positive engagement helps prevent slippage and maintains a consistent relationship between the input and output shafts.

For this reason, timing pulleys are particularly suitable for machinery requiring precise timing, synchronization, and positioning.

One of the most important factors in timing pulley manufacturing is ensuring that the pulley tooth profile correctly matches the timing belt.

Incompatibility between belt pitch, tooth profile, number of teeth, and pulley geometry can result in irregular operation, vibration, premature belt wear, and reduced service life.

Tooth Profiles Compatible with Timing Belts

The tooth profile of a timing pulley must be compatible with the type of timing belt used in the system.

Timing belts with different pitches and tooth profiles are used across various industrial applications. Therefore, before manufacturing, it is essential to determine not only the external dimensions of the pulley but also the specifications of the belt.

Depending on the application, technical parameters considered during manufacturing include:

  • Belt profile

  • Belt pitch

  • Number of teeth

  • Pulley diameter

  • Tooth width

  • Shaft bore

  • Hub design

  • Keyway

  • Flange configuration

  • Material

Materials

The material used for a timing pulley can be selected according to rotational speed, transmitted load, operating duration, weight requirements, and environmental conditions.

Depending on the application, timing pulleys can be manufactured from:

  • 4140

  • 8620

  • 1040

  • 17CrNiMo6

  • Aluminum

  • Cast Polyamide

  • Bronze

Other materials suitable for specific project requirements can also be evaluated.

Aluminum may be preferred in applications where reducing weight is important, while suitable steel grades can be used in systems requiring higher mechanical strength.

What Is the Difference Between a Timing Pulley and a Chain Sprocket?

Although both systems can be used to transmit rotary motion with minimal or no slippage, their operating principles and characteristics differ.

Chain sprockets operate with metal chains, while timing pulleys operate with toothed synchronous belts.

Chain drive systems may be preferred for heavy loads and demanding operating conditions, whereas timing belt systems can provide significant advantages in applications requiring quieter operation, lower weight, higher speeds, and precise synchronization.

The appropriate system should be selected according to transmitted load, rotational speed, required precision, environmental conditions, and maintenance requirements.

Timing Pulley Manufacturing for Maintenance and Overhaul

Timing pulley tooth surfaces may become worn or mechanically damaged after extended periods of operation.

Wear on the tooth profile can affect proper engagement between the timing belt and pulley, reducing system accuracy and potentially accelerating belt wear.
